The first is the mobile version of the GTX1050TI core, N17P-G1-A1, which is significantly different from the GP107-400-A1 core number of the desktop version of the GTX1050TI. The GPU core uses three-phase power supply and has one phase of memory. The memory uses four 32-bit Samsung GDDR5s with 1GB capacity to form a 4GB 128-bit GDDR5 memory bank.

The I-7700HQ is a BGA solderable non-replaceable motherboard. The core of the I-7700HQ is also rectangular. Like the lower square PCH South Bridge, there is no logo that clearly identifies the model. The CPU power supply design adopts a 5-phase power supply design, in which the core three phases have two phases. In fact, the current software still can not identify the PCH South Bridge, but I suspect that not HM170 is HM175.

9, GPU recognition

This mobile version of the GTX1050TI really surprised me, the desktop version of the TMUS is 48, mobile version increased to 64, and the core frequency is directly on the desktop version of the 1293 increased by 200MHz, while the BOOST frequency is from the desktop version On the basis of 1392 increased to 1620MHz, while other parameters basically did not change.

The panel used by this T2 is LG LP156WF6-SPK3

Screen library data is LG original AH-IPS screen, 6bit panel, FHD resolution, contrast 700:1, here also can be confused about the reason I just viewed the general angle, the data display is up and down, left and right viewing angles are For a minimum of 80 degrees, this is a different concept from the maximum 178 degrees of viewable angles advertised by manufacturers.

In terms of heat dissipation, the temperature of the I-7700HQ does decrease

AIDA64 FPU single copy CPU, FURMARK copy GPU, dual full load in the case of 15 minutes, CPU 77 degrees, GPU 62 degrees, to be honest, for a laptop, the full load pager temperature is very satisfactory, If you replace the I7 6700HQ and GTX960M at this time on the cooling of this mold has been properly CPU near 90 degrees, and the GPU will be above 75 degrees, and I7 7700HQ with GTX1050TI mobile version of the configuration makes people feel relieved too Too much, let me feel very sensible to make a decision to replace the T7 game book of I7 6700HQ and GTX960M!
